Introduction to Industrial Freeze Drying Machines

An industrial freeze drying machine is a powerful piece of equipment used to remove moisture from products while keeping their original structure, quality, and nutrients intact. This technology industrial freeze drying machine is widely used in food processing, pharmaceuticals, biotechnology, and chemical industries. Freeze drying is considered one of the best preservation methods because it extends product shelf life without causing major changes to appearance, flavor, or effectiveness.

The process works by freezing the product and then removing ice through a process called sublimation. During sublimation, ice changes directly into vapor without becoming liquid. This helps maintain the product’s quality and stability for long-term storage.

How Freeze Drying Technology Works

The freeze drying process generally consists of three important stages:

Freezing Stage

The product is first frozen at very low temperatures. This step converts all water content into solid ice crystals.

Primary Drying Stage

A vacuum environment is created inside the chamber. Under low pressure, ice begins to turn directly into vapor. Most of the moisture is removed during this stage.

Secondary Drying Stage

Any remaining moisture is eliminated to achieve the desired dryness level. The final product becomes lightweight, stable, and easy to store.

This carefully controlled process helps preserve the product’s original properties better than many other drying methods.

Key Components of an Industrial Freeze Drying Machine

Several important parts work together to ensure effective operation.

Drying Chamber

The chamber holds the products during the freeze drying process. It is designed to maintain precise temperature and pressure conditions.

Vacuum System

The vacuum system lowers the pressure inside the chamber, allowing sublimation to occur efficiently.

Refrigeration Unit

This unit freezes the product and keeps the system operating at the required low temperatures.

Control System

Modern industrial freeze dryers use advanced control panels to monitor temperature, pressure, and processing times for consistent results.

Condenser

The condenser captures water vapor removed from the product and converts it back into ice, preventing moisture from re-entering the chamber.

Benefits of Industrial Freeze Drying Machines

Many industries choose freeze drying because of its significant advantages.

Excellent Product Quality

Freeze drying preserves shape, color, texture, flavor, and nutritional value better than many traditional drying methods.

Long Shelf Life

Products can remain stable for months or even years when properly packaged after freeze drying.

Reduced Product Weight

Removing water significantly reduces product weight, making transportation and storage easier.

Improved Storage Convenience

Many freeze-dried products can be stored at room temperature, reducing refrigeration costs.

High Product Stability

Sensitive ingredients, medicines, and biological materials maintain their effectiveness for longer periods.

Applications in Pharmaceutical Manufacturing

Pharmaceutical companies use industrial freeze drying machines to preserve temperature-sensitive medicines and vaccines.

Many medical products contain ingredients that can lose effectiveness when exposed to heat or moisture. Freeze drying helps maintain product stability and extends shelf life. This makes transportation and storage more reliable, especially for critical healthcare products.

Applications in Biotechnology

Biotechnology laboratories and production facilities use freeze drying technology to preserve microorganisms, enzymes, proteins, and biological samples.

The process allows researchers and manufacturers to store valuable materials for extended periods without significant degradation.
